See Through Smoke and Shadows: Applications of FLIR Thermal Imaging

Flir thermal imaging reveals the world through a different lens. Unlike conventional cameras that capture visible light, Flir devices detect infrared radiation emitted by objects. This unique capability allows us to identify temperature variations, creating representations where heat becomes apparent. These remarkable images present invaluable information across a vast array of fields.

From locating lost individuals in smoke-filled environments to monitoring the integrity of electrical equipment, Flir thermal imaging exhibits its versatility and crucial role.

In the domain of search and rescue, Flir sensors become lifesavers, allowing responders to locate survivors trapped amidst debris or obscured by smoke. The capacity to see through these hazards can mean the distinction between life and death.

Moreover, Flir thermal imaging contributes a vital role in industrial inspections. By identifying subtle temperature variations, technicians can uncover potential problems before they lead to costly downtime or systemic disruptions.
